What made Muslim Spain a unique and successful society? Richard Hitchcock explores the background to its powerful legacy in the formation of modern Spain. Students will learn about the main historical developments in depth, such as the self-defeating independence of the Taifas, the so-called ‘Party Kings’, and the prolonged colonisation of the Muslim subject population under the increasingly severe dominance of the Kingdoms of Aragon and Castile.
